Where is 'Farm Wants a Wife' star Ryan Black from? Where does he live now?

Ryan hails from the town of Shelby in North Carolina. According to a report from Axios Charlotte, Ryan's family owns a wide assortment of farms across the state of North Carolina.

The Farmer Wants a Wife star currently resides in Gastonia, N.C., which is just about a half-hour drive from Ryan's hometown of Shelby.

Ryan told Axios Charlotte that it's not a challenge for him to find women to date in Charlotte; however, he wisely noted, "There’s a certain attraction to cowboys. The complicated part is finding the connection instead of infatuation."

What does 'Farmer Wants a Wife' star Ryan Black do for a living?

He studied at UNC North Carolina, and currently specializes in training and breeding horses on his — get this — 44-acre ranch. What's better than a man who loves animals?

Ryan does view himself as a chivalrous man, telling Axios Charlotte, "One of the most chivalrous things a man can do, it may sound deeper and it’s really not, is listening. Just listening and paying attention goes a long way,"

His favorite first-date spot outside of the farm is The Eagle Food and Beer Hall in Charlotte, on the strength of their maple bacon alone.
